The term LCD stands for Liquid Crystal Display. This is the technology behind many modern screens and projectors, allowing for a seamless presentation of images. In terms of projection, LCD technology is essential for delivering clear and vibrant visuals, as it utilises liquid crystals to manipulate and control light in a way that results in improved picture quality.
An LCD projector is a device that uses Liquid Crystal Display technology to produce images on a screen or surface. Unlike traditional projection methods, it splits light into its constituent colours and then recombines them to form a full-colour image. This allows for rich visuals and accurate colour reproduction, making them a popular choice for home theatres, business presentations, and educational environments.
Understanding how lcd projectors work begins with looking at their core components. These projectors use three separate LCD panels for red, green, and blue channels. The mechanism involves a high-intensity light source that shines through the LCD panels, where dichroic prisms and filters carefully manage the light, ensuring that each colour is accurately displayed. This process is at the heart of lcd projector technology and is instrumental in creating the vivid images we enjoy on-screen.
When it comes to creating an image, the process is remarkably interesting yet straightforward. The light passes through each of the three LCD chips corresponding to red, green, and blue. By adjusting the pixels on these panels, the projector can reproduce a full spectrum of colours. This combination of red, green, and blue light creates the detailed images we see on our screens, making this technology ideal for scenarios that require colour precision and clarity.

A common query among tech enthusiasts is the difference between lcd projector and LED projector technologies. In terms of brightness and colour accuracy, lcd projectors are typically superior due to their three-panel system which processes colours separately. However, LED projectors offer benefits like longer lifespans and greater energy efficiency. Each technology has its own advantages, meaning the best choice often depends on your specific requirements and usage scenario.

LCD projectors come in a variety of types tailored to different usage scenarios. There are models designed specifically for home theatre systems, delivering cinematic experiences right in your living room. Business-oriented models are built to handle large presentations, while portable versions are perfect for on-the-go requirements. The variety in types of lcd projectors ensures that there is a fitting option regardless of whether you are a professional, a tech enthusiast, or a casual user looking to enjoy media at home.
Modern lcd projector features include higher resolutions such as 4K, wireless connectivity for a clutter-free setup, and even built-in speakers that enhance the multimedia experience. These advancements cater to a range of needs—be it immersive gaming, detailed business presentations, or interactive educational projects. The integration of these features in lcd projectors makes them not just a projection tool, but a versatile device that adapts to diverse environments and requirements.
One of the primary advantages of lcd projectors is their ability to produce highly rated brightness and colour accuracy. The use of Liquid Crystal Display technology ensures that images are reproduced with high fidelity, making them an ideal choice for settings that demand precision. Additionally, these projectors are often more affordable than other advanced systems, offering a cost-effective solution without compromising on performance. Their lightweight design and durability further contribute to their growing popularity across various sectors.
